so i sadly got a flat on my 01 Golf GTi. this is the first flat i've gotten and when i bought the car it didn't have a manual. can anyone explain to me or have a pic of where to put the jack? the car is in my parking spot so it's no big hurry but i'd like to take care of it this weekend and i don't want to f anything up. it's the rear driver's tire btw. thanks!

You usually put the jack on the jack points, which are flat spots right behind the front tires, and in front of the back tires.  Also, there's pinch welds you can jack it up on too.

yeah i guess i just want to make sure i know where the jack points are, i screwed up my grand prix a little (my first car) by putting the jack in the wrong place.

p.s. what are pinch welds?

look under the car....pinch welds would be the thick body lining along the frame.  Most tire places will place their jacks there for R&I tires.  As soon as you see it, you'll know what I'm talkiong about.
